Out of 106 genotypes only 7 genotypes viz., Path 402 , Path 407 , NDA-14-4, NDA-14-15, NDA-14-16, NDA-14-29, NDA-14-36 were resistant against A.tenuissima under artificial inoculation conditions by spraying inoculums. Seventeen plant extracts were evaluated in vitro and in vivo. The effectiveness of extracts increased with the increase of their concentration and maximum inhibition was recorded at 15 per cent concentration at 7 days of incubation in vitro. The complete inhibition in radial growth was obtained in Neem followed by Eucalyptus, Garlic, Mehandi, Ginger,Tulsi, Madar, Kaner, Onion, Lantana, Sadabahar, Ashok, Bael, Bhang, Clerodendron, Parthenium and Marigold. The disease incidence was not much reduced by Clerodendron, Parthenium and Marigold at 15% concentration at 60 days after spraying. The same trend was also found in per cent disease control. However, per cent disease control in between Neem and Eucalyptus; Garlic and Mehandi; Ginger and Tulsi ; Kaner and Onion; Lantana and Sadabahar; Bael and Bhang; Parthenium and Marigold were at par to each other. The The lower per cent disease control was found in Clerodendron, Parthenium and Marigold.
